MSc Electric Vehicle Engineering with Placement Year
Course Overview
This MSc in Electric Vehicle Engineering is a forward-thinking postgraduate program designed to equip you with the advanced skills to design and develop the next generation of smart, sustainable mobility solutions. The curriculum integrates core principles from electrics, electronics, and control systems to master the entire EV powertrain, from power electronics and battery technology to autonomous digital systems. You will gain the practical and academic expertise to transform innovative concepts into real-world applications, supported by an optional industry placement to connect your learning with professional experience.
Key Program Highlights
- Comprehensive mastery of the EV powertrain, including electrical machines, drives, power electronics, and battery technology
- Focus on designing smart, cognitive, and autonomous systems that interact with their environment using sensor data
- Integration of key engineering disciplines: electrics, electronics, control, power, automation, and robotics
- Hands-on learning to take projects from initial concept through to prototyping and testing
- Optional industry placement year to gain valuable real-world experience and enhance career prospects
